#7805a9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7805a9 is composed of 47.1% red, 2%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29% cyan, 97%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 282.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 34.1%. #7805a9 color hex could be obtained by blending #f00aff with #000053.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

Shades and Tints of #7805a9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0011 is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#7805a9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585559 is the less saturated color, while #7805a9 is the most saturated one.
